Reflux and anxiety: Anxiety and other stress related psychological symptoms are linked to "fight-flight" reaction, cortisol secretion and many other autonomic system reactions. These in turn affect stomach acid production as well as smooth muscles that control sphincters. Acid reflux and its extension to laryngotracheal reflux is one of the possible links. "He was so scared that he soiled himself" -- a known event.
